Wanted, I didn't say anyone was scared to run VIIIs. I said people have been scared INTO running parts they don't need, such as head studs, ignition amplifiers, and fuel rails - all on stock turbo'd cars. I said I _only_ run one step colder plugs, and that is all I need to run 11.5s on the stock turbo - nothing more.

I also didn't say Buschur was the rest of the world, and I didn't say they were _the_ end-all/be-all. I said "some" of the best, and I specifically chose that word. Your comment that Buschur pushes his parts to the limit and can replace them isn't even relevant to my comments, because I am talking about CUSTOMERS of his, not the shop cars, although the shop cars can be included, too. They have built customer cars without touching the fuel rail, because it is not necessary even when flowing vastly more fuel than we could ever imagine on the stock or near-stock turbo.

Unlike you, if Buschur did it, I _would_ do it. They have definitely proven themselves, and we're talking about cars that aren't even in the same galaxy as the ones discussed in this thread. People should not be scared into purchasing parts like this when there isn't data to support it. Just wrapping the safety clause around it isn't fair. There are PLENTY of things we do that push the limits more than using a stock fuel rail on the stock turbo...
If you had have worded the comment about 8 series plugs to begin with, that would not have come up in my post. What you write now is actually worded better and I can agree with that.

The only example you cited was one of Buschurs cars. Please cite us examples of other companies pushing that kind of power without the rail if you truly want to take a well rounded approach. If you re-read my posing in the thread I linked, that's the approach I took. No where in there did i ever say it can't be done, but I did explain some critical differences.

Finally, I realize you would. A lot of us do. And while you are correct in that people shouldn't be scared into buying them, they also should not be scared into not buying them as well. People deserve to know ALL the facts, which means both sides. It's critical in making an informed decision. The person who's car was shown did in fact have a fuel rail he chose not to run and has for sale. I can guarantee that Buschur explained both both the pro's and cons to him about whether or not to use it, and would have run it if the customer said install it.
